Abstract
951,604. Signalling, demarcation and like lights. MEINERS OPTICAL DEVICES Ltd. Feb. 29, 1960 [March 3, 1959; May 6, 1959 (2)], Nos. 7358/59, 15552/59 and 15553/59. Heading F4R. A lamp for producing a beam of great visual range e.g. for signalling, guiding and similar lights comprises a light source without a reflector behind it and a lens system for producing a substantially parallel-sided beam and power means for oscillating the beam or moving it orbitally to produce an effect of considerable divergence. In its simplest form, a light source 11, Fig. 1, which may be associated with a stop 13 is enclosed in a tube 12 and arranged so that the source or the stop is at the focus of a convex lens 14 so that a parallel beam is produced which falls on a mirror 17 oscillated by a lever 20 acted on by a cam 21. In alternative arrangements (a) the lamp is fixed and the housing 12 carrying the lens 14 is oscillated; (b) a revolving prism is interposed in the beam between the lamp 11 and the lens 14; (c) the lamp 11 or the stop 13 is reciprocated by a cam, the lens 14 being fixed; and (d) the lamp 11, Fig. 5, is arranged behind a central aperture in a concave mirror 27 opposite which is a mirror 28 carried by a magnet 29 mounted on a balljoint at 30 and oscillated by current passing through windings 31, the light reflected from the mirror 27 passing to the lens 14.
